Top EPL Star ‘Close’ To Barca Switch

After missing out on Nico Williams, FC Barcelona has shifted attention to the English Premier League for one of their other top transfer targets.

Multiple reports from Spain had indicated that Barcelona were closing in on Nico Williams and that negotiations were ongoing to secure the 22-year-old's services.

Barcelona reportedly agreed personal terms with Williams, but the Euro 2024 winner made a big transfer u-turn when he signed a new deal with Athletic Club to keep him at the club until 2035.

According to Mundo Deportivo, the Blaugrana shifted its attention to Liverpool winger Luis Diaz after missing out on Williams.

Those close to Diaz reportedly told the Catalan club of the Colombian's desire to join the club, in the hopes that the Williams deal fell through.

Sources within the club indicated that Diaz's agent is not demanding any mandatory registration clauses or free-release guarantees if the club fails to register him. 

The publication reported further that Diaz planned to request a transfer from Liverpool, but the Spanish club are not expecting it to happen soon following the death of Diogo Jota, Diaz's former teammate and close friend.

Barca Universal reported that Barcelona have also kept tabs on Manchester United forward Marcus Rashford. The 27-year-old was deemed surplus to requirements at Old Trafford and is reportedly keen on a move to Spain.  

Rashford has a contract with Manchester United until 2028. However, United want to sell him, and the price is likely to be set around €40 million (R834 million).

Despite the cheaper valuation, Luis Diaz remains Barcelona's number one priority, but the Colombian would reportedly set the club back around €90 million (R1.8 billion).
